G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es in Marshall Islands
Marshall Islands: G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es was 106.7% in 2019. ▲ Rising
G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es in Marshall Islands, 1999–2019
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2019, g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es in Marshall Islands stood at 106.7%. That is the highest value across all 12 years on record.
The figure is up 125.3% on the previous year and up 54.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es in Marshall Islands peaked at 106.7% in 2019 and was at its lowest, 47.4%, in 2016.
Marshall Islands ranks 35th of 182 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 12 years of available data.
Gross enrolment ratio, upper secondary, both sexes in Marshall Islands,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1999 | 54.1% | — |
| 2002 | 53.8% | -0.5% |
| 2003 | 50.4% | -6.5% |
| 2004 | 50.8% | +1.0% |
| 2005 | 49.7% | -2.2% |
| 2006 | 56.3% | +13.2% |
| 2007 | 62.2% | +10.5% |
| 2008 | 67.3% | +8.3% |
| 2009 | 69.0% | +2.5% |
| 2015 | 55.4% | -19.8% |
| 2016 | 47.4% | -14.4% |
| 2019 | 106.7% | +125.3% |

About this data
Total enrollment in upper secondary education, regardless of age, expressed as a percentage of the total population of official upper secondary education age.
